Types of Filters Available

As I researched, I found that there are different types of filters available for my DL 50mm F2.8 LS Asph lens. The most common types include UV filters, polarizing filters, and neutral density filters. Each type serves a unique purpose. For instance, UV filters protect the lens, polarizing filters reduce reflections, and neutral density filters allow me to use slower shutter speeds in bright conditions.

Optical Quality Matters

I’ve learned that not all filters are created equal. The optical quality of the filter can significantly affect the image quality. I tend to look for filters that are made from high-quality glass and have anti-reflective coatings. This helps to maintain the clarity and sharpness of my images.

Filter Coatings

In my experience, filter coatings can play a vital role in how my images turn out. Multi-coated filters tend to produce better results by reducing flare and ghosting. I always check for this feature when considering a filter for my lens.

Size and Thickness

The size and thickness of the filter are also important factors for me. A thicker filter might cause vignetting, especially when shooting at wider apertures. I usually opt for slim filters to avoid this issue, ensuring that they fit comfortably on my lens without obstructing my shots.
